首页 开发百科文章正文

java连接数据库常见错误有哪些类型的问题

开发百科 2025年11月20日 15:34 242 admin

Java连接数据库常见错误类型解析与解决策略

在Java开发过程中,连接数据库是常见的操作,由于各种原因,开发者可能会遇到一些连接数据库时的错误,这些错误不仅会影响程序的正常运行,还可能导致数据丢失或系统崩溃,了解这些错误类型并掌握相应的解决策略至关重要,本文将介绍Java连接数据库时的常见错误类型,并提供相应的解决建议。

java连接数据库常见错误有哪些类型的问题

数据库连接失败

当Java程序尝试连接到数据库时,如果无法建立连接,就会出现数据库连接失败的错误,这通常是由于数据库服务器未启动、网络问题、数据库配置错误等原因导致的,为了解决这个问题,首先需要检查数据库服务器是否已启动,网络连接是否正常,然后检查数据库配置文件中的参数设置是否正确。

SQL语法错误

SQL语法错误是指Java程序在执行SQL语句时,由于语法错误导致查询无法执行,这种错误可能是由于程序员对SQL语句的书写不规范,或者在拼接字符串时出现了错误,为了避免这种错误,程序员在编写SQL语句时应该遵循正确的语法规则,使用预编译语句来防止SQL注入攻击。

数据库超时

java连接数据库常见错误有哪些类型的问题

数据库超时是指在Java程序等待数据库响应的过程中,由于数据库处理速度过慢或其他原因导致程序无法在规定时间内获得响应,这种情况下,程序会抛出一个超时异常,为了解决这个问题,可以调整数据库的配置参数,提高数据库的处理能力,或者优化SQL查询语句,减少数据库的负载。

数据类型不匹配

数据类型不匹配是指Java程序在插入或更新数据库时,由于字段的数据类型与传入的值不匹配而导致的错误,这种错误可能是由于程序员在编写代码时没有正确处理数据类型转换,或者在拼接字符串时出现了错误,为了避免这种错误,程序员在编写代码时应该确保数据类型的一致性,并在必要时进行适当的数据类型转换。

并发访问冲突

并发访问冲突是指在多线程环境下,多个线程同时访问和修改同一个数据库记录时,由于竞争条件导致的数据不一致问题,为了避免这种错误,可以使用数据库提供的事务管理功能,确保数据的一致性和完整性,还可以采用乐观锁或悲观锁等机制来控制并发访问。

Java连接数据库时可能会遇到各种错误,为了确保程序的稳定运行,程序员需要对这些错误类型有所了解,并掌握相应的解决策略。

标签: 数据库连接错误

发表评论

丫丫技术百科 备案号:新ICP备2024010732号-62